Grilling Perfection: Tips for Juicy Chicken Burgers
Chicken burgers, due to their lower fat content, can sometimes be prone to drying out. However, with this recipe, we’ve taken measures to ensure a moist and flavorful result. The Panko breadcrumbs help retain moisture, while the mixed-in pesto adds a layer of richness and flavor. For best results, after forming your patties, cover and refrigerate them for at least a couple of hours. This crucial step allows the flavors to meld beautifully and helps the patties firm up, making them easier to handle on the grill. When it comes to grilling, medium-high heat is ideal. Avoid constantly pressing down on the patties, as this can squeeze out valuable juices. Flip them only once to get a beautiful sear and ensure even cooking. Always check for an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) to ensure they are safely cooked. If outdoor grilling isn’t an option, these burgers cook wonderfully in a cast iron skillet, achieving a similar delicious crust and juicy interior.

Rueda Verdejo: Bright, Crisp, and Refreshing
The Rueda Verdejo, a standout white grape varietal, is everything you want in a wine to accompany fresh, flavorful grilled dishes. It’s wonderfully bright, impeccably crisp, and delightfully creative in its aromatic profile. Expect notes of green apple, grapefruit, and a distinct herbal character, sometimes with a subtle bitter almond finish that adds complexity. The climate of the Rueda wine region is almost tailor-made for the Verdejo grape, characterized by hot days and refreshingly cool nights. This diurnal temperature variation allows the grapes to develop complexity while retaining their crucial acidity, resulting in wines that are both full-bodied and exceptionally fresh. It’s no wonder that Rueda Verdejo holds the prestigious title of the #1 white wine market leader in Spain. Its vibrant acidity and subtle herbal notes cut through the richness of the cheddar and complement the fresh spinach pesto beautifully, making it an ideal companion for our chicken burgers, especially on a warm summer evening.
Ribera del Duero Tempranillo: Bold, Rugged, and Rich
While the Verdejo offered a crisp contrast, the Ribera del Duero Tempranillo provides a deeper, more robust experience. This red grape varietal produces wines that are bold, rugged, and wonderfully ripe, boasting a natural fruitiness and profound flavor that captivates the palate. The Ribera del Duero region is defined by its dramatic landscape – hot summers, frigid winters, and a challenging rocky, rigid terrain. These extreme conditions, along with the region’s high altitude, stress the Tempranillo vines, forcing them to produce grapes with concentrated flavors and exceptional structure. This unique environment creates a pure paradise for cultivating Tempranillo grapes, resulting in wines known for their intensity, dark fruit flavors, and often notes of vanilla, leather, and tobacco from oak aging. These wines are powerful yet elegant, with a long, satisfying finish. It’s truly remarkable that Ribera del Duero is ranked as the #2 red wine region in Spain overall and was even named the 2012 Wine Region of the Year by Wine Enthusiast. - 1 lb. ground chicken
- 1 Tbsp balsamic vinegar
- 2 tsp low sodium soy sauce
- 1 tsp fresh lemon juice
- 1/2 tsp chili powder
- 1/4 cup shredded sharp cheddar cheese
- 3/4 cup Panko breadcrumbs
- For the Pesto:
- 5 oz. fresh baby spinach
- 1/2 small white or yellow onion
- 2 cloves of garlic
- 3 green onions, roughly chopped
- Begin by preparing your fresh pesto. Place the spinach, half an onion, garlic cloves, and chopped green onions into a food processor. Pulse until it reaches a beautiful, vibrant pesto consistency – avoid over-processing it into a paste. A few quick pulses should achieve the desired texture, as shown in the image above detailing the pesto ingredients.
- In a large mixing bowl, combine the ground chicken with the Panko breadcrumbs, shredded sharp cheddar cheese, chili powder, fresh lemon juice, low sodium soy sauce, and balsamic vinegar. Mix these ingredients thoroughly until they are well incorporated. Now, gently fold the freshly prepared pesto into this chicken mixture. Using clean hands often works best to ensure everything is evenly distributed.
- Once the mixture is ready, form it into 4 or 5 uniformly sized patties, depending on your desired burger size. For optimal flavor development and to help the patties hold their shape better during grilling, cover them and refrigerate for at least two hours.
- Heat your grill to medium-high heat. Place the chicken patties on the hot grill and cook, flipping only once, until they reach your desired doneness and are cooked through (internal temperature of 165°F or 74°C). Alternatively, if grilling outdoors isn’t an option, you can cook these delicious burgers in a cast iron skillet over medium-high heat for a few minutes on each side until golden brown and cooked through.
- Serve these amazing burgers on your favorite hamburger buns. Garnish with additional cheddar cheese, a dollop of BBQ sauce, crisp lettuce, fresh tomato slices, or any other toppings you love. Enjoy your gourmet summer meal!
